2020 Supreme(Kar) 976

B.V.NAGARATHNA, RAVI V.HOSMANI
Siddamma – Appellant
Versus
Nayeem Basha – Respondent


Advocates Appeared:
Saritha Kulkarni, Advocate, Ashok N Patil, Advocate

JUDGMENT

B V Nagarathna, J. - Though this matter is listed for admission, with the consent of learned counsel on both sides, it is heard finally and disposed of by this judgment.

2. The appellants are the widow and sons of Halappa, who died in a road traffic accident and who are seeking enhancement of compensation by assailing the judgment and award passed by he III Addl. Senior Civil Judge & VII Motor Vehicle Accident Tribunal (hereinafter, referred to as 'Tribunal' for brevity) Davanagere, in M.V.C.No.909/2014, which was disposed of on 05.06.2017.

3. For the sake of convenience, the parties herein shall be referred to in terms of their status before the Tribunal.

4. It is the case of the claimants that Halappa, was sitting under a tree in front of his house on 17.11.2014 at about 11.45 a.m., when at that time respondent No.1 being the driver of vehicle bearing registration No.KA-01/A-6958 drove the same in a rash and negligent manner on Kukkuvada road and though Halappa tried to escape from the lorry, he was nevertheless hit by it and fell down, the rear wheel passed over the head of Halappa, as a result of which, he sustained serious injuries and died on the spot.
